The Importance of Risk Management

Risk is an inherent part of investing. By understanding and effectively managing risk, investors can protect their capital and minimize potential losses. Here are some key reasons why risk management is essential:

  • 1. Capital Preservation: The primary goal of risk management is to preserve capital. By identifying and assessing potential risks, investors can make informed decisions to protect their investment principal.
  • 2. Consistent Returns: Implementing risk management strategies can help investors achieve consistent returns over time. By avoiding excessive risk-taking and maintaining a balanced approach, investors can minimize the impact of market volatility on their portfolio.
  • 3. Long-Term Success: A disciplined approach to risk management increases the likelihood of long-term success. By managing risk effectively, investors can stay on track with their financial goals and avoid significant setbacks.

Strategies for Effective Risk Management

1. Diversification

Diversification is a fundamental risk management strategy. By spreading investments across different asset classes, sectors, and geographic regions, investors can reduce their exposure to any single investment and mitigate the impact of market fluctuations. Diversification can be achieved through a mix of stocks, bonds, real estate, and other asset classes.

2. Asset Allocation

Asset allocation is another critical aspect of risk management. By allocating investments across various asset classes based on risk tolerance and investment goals, investors can create a well-balanced portfolio. A diversified asset allocation strategy considers factors such as age, financial objectives, and risk tolerance to ensure an appropriate mix of risk and potential return.

3. Research and Due Diligence

Thorough research and due diligence are essential for effective risk management. Before making any investment, investors should carefully evaluate the fundamentals of the asset, including the company’s financials, industry trends, and potential risks. Conducting proper research can help investors make informed decisions and avoid investments that may pose significant risks.

4. Risk vs. Reward Assessment

Assessing the risk-reward ratio is crucial in managing investments. Investors should evaluate the potential return of an investment against the level of risk involved. By considering the potential upside and downside of an investment, investors can make more informed decisions and avoid excessive risk-taking.

5. Regular Monitoring and Review

Risk management is an ongoing process. Regular monitoring and review of investments are essential to identify changes in risk factors, market conditions, and individual investments. By staying informed and proactively adjusting the portfolio when necessary, investors can adapt to changing circumstances and mitigate potential risks.

Furthermore, it’s important to acknowledge that risk tolerance varies among individuals. Some investors may have a higher tolerance for risk and seek higher returns, while others may prefer a more conservative approach. Understanding your risk tolerance and aligning your investment strategy accordingly is essential for effective risk management.

The Role of Risk Management in Uncertain Times

In uncertain times, such as economic downturns or market volatility, risk management becomes even more critical. Here are some additional considerations for managing risk during uncertain periods:

  • 1. Maintain a Long-Term Perspective: Market fluctuations are a natural part of investing. It’s important to maintain a long-term perspective and not make hasty decisions based on short-term market movements. By staying focused on your long-term investment goals, you can avoid reacting impulsively to market volatility.
  • 2. Regularly Rebalance Your Portfolio: Market volatility can cause asset allocation to deviate from your target allocation. Regularly rebalancing your portfolio ensures that your investments remain aligned with your risk tolerance and investment objectives. Rebalancing involves selling investments that have performed well and buying more of those that have underperformed, thus maintaining your desired asset allocation.
  • 3. Stay Informed and Seek Professional Advice: Keeping abreast of economic news, market trends, and industry developments can help you make informed decisions. Additionally, consulting with a financial advisor who specializes in risk management can provide valuable insights and guidance tailored to your specific situation.
  • 4. Consider Alternative Investments: During uncertain times, diversifying your portfolio beyond traditional stocks and bonds can be beneficial. Alternative investments, such as real estate, commodities, or private equity, can provide additional diversification and potentially lower correlation to traditional asset classes.
  • 5. Review and Update Your Risk Management Strategy: Periodically reassess your risk management strategy to ensure it aligns with your changing financial goals, risk tolerance, and market conditions. What may have been an appropriate risk management approach in the past may need adjustments in response to evolving circumstances.

Car insurance has been a crucial part of owning a vehicle for many years. It protects drivers and their assets in case of accidents or theft. In 2023, the need for car insurance
has become even more important due to various factors. In this article, we will discuss why car insurance is essential in 2023 and the benefits of having a comprehensive policy.

  1. Protecting Your Assets

One of the most significant benefits of car insurance is that it protects your assets. In case of an accident or theft, the insurance company will cover the cost of repairs or replacement of your vehicle. Without car insurance, you would have to bear the financial burden of repairing or replacing your car, which can be a significant expense.

Legal Requirements

Car insurance is a legal requirement in most states. If you are caught driving without insurance, you could face fines, penalties, and even legal action. In some states, you may also face license suspension and vehicle impoundment.

Peace of Mind

Having car insurance can give you peace of mind knowing that you are protected in case of an accident or theft. Knowing that you won’t have to bear the financial burden of repairs or replacement can reduce your stress levels and allow you to drive with confidence.

Protection Against Uninsured Drivers

Unfortunately, not everyone follows the law and carries car insurance. If you are involved in an accident with an uninsured driver, you could be left with significant expenses. However, if you have uninsured motorist coverage, your insurance company will cover the costs of damages and medical expenses.

Emerging Technologies

As technology continues to advance, so does the need for car insurance. With the increasing popularity of electric and self-driving cars, the risks and costs associated with repairing these vehicles are often higher than traditional gasoline cars. Car insurance policies that specifically cater to electric or self-driving cars can help ensure that owners of these vehicles are protected in case of accidents or damages.

Flexibility and Customization

Car insurance policies offer flexibility and customization, allowing drivers to choose the coverage that suits their needs and budget. By customizing their policies, drivers can ensure that they are protected against specific risks and tailor their coverage to fit their lifestyle and driving habits.
